Abstract
An evaporator for a refrigerator, in particular a domestic refrigerator, includes at least one refrigerant channel and at least one plate. The plate has a receptacle, arranged in a space defined by the refrigerant channel, for positioning a tube. The receptacle is formed by at least one projection, which forms a longitudinal guide of the tube. The projection is formed on the at least one plate and defines a channel having a channel wall upon which the tube bears at least partially in a longitudinal direction. The tube is, for example, a protective tube for a temperature sensor.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 - 11 . (canceled)
12 . An evaporator for a refrigerator, comprising:
at least one refrigerant channel; and at least one plate comprising a receptacle, arranged in a space defined by the refrigerant channel, for positioning a tube, said receptacle being formed by at least one projection to establish a longitudinal guide of the tube, said projection being formed on the plate and defining a channel having a channel wall upon which the tube bears at least partially in a longitudinal direction; said projection being formed with a recess extending in a longitudinal direction for at least partially supporting the tube in the longitudinal direction.
13 . The evaporator of claim 12 , for use in a domestic refrigerator.
14 . The evaporator of claim 12 , further comprising an adhesive for fastening the tube to the at least one plate, when the tube bears against the longitudinal guide.
15 . The evaporator of claim 14 , wherein the adhesive is an adhesive strip made of plastics.
16 . The evaporator of claim 14 , wherein the adhesive is an adhesive strip comprising an aluminum coating.
17 . The evaporator of claim 12 , wherein the tube forms a protective tube for a temperature sensor.
18 . The evaporator of claim 12 , wherein the tube is embedded in the longitudinal guide.
19 . The evaporator of claim 12 , constructed in the form of a roll-bond or Z-bond evaporator, with the channel being a blind channel.
